
Between 2005–06, the last year of actual data, and 2018–19, the number of high school graduates is projected to increase nationally by 9 percent. Public schools are expected to have an increase in high school graduates, and private schools are expected to have a decrease. Increases are expected in the Midwest, West, and South, and a decrease is expected in the Northeast.
Projected increases in the number of graduates reflect changes in the 18-year-old population over the projection period, rather than changes in the graduation rates of 12th-graders. Projections of graduates could be affected by changes in policies influencing graduation requirements.
